Just thought I'd post this here for anyone else who uses radio tray. I've gotten a small but useful collection of classical stations. I'd be interested in Blues, if anyone has a good collection. Look under:

~/.local/share/radiotray

open your bookmarks.xml file with something like leafpad

Look for <group name="Classical">

You can either cut & paste the following:


<group name="Classical"><bookmark name="KDFC" url="http://provisioning.streamtheworld.com/pls/KDFCFM.pls"/><bookmark name="Classic FM" url="http://media-ice.musicradio.com/ClassicFMMP3.m3u"/><bookmark name="WCPE" url="http://www.ibiblio.org/wcpe/wcpe.pls"/><bookmark name="CINEMIX" url="http://cinemix.us/cine.asx"/><bookmark name="Swiss Classic Radio" url="http://www.radioswissclassic.ch/live/aacp.m3u"/><bookmark name="Radio Mozart" url="http://listen.radionomy.com/radio-mozart"/><bookmark name="Baroque Around the Clock" url="http://shoutcast.omroep.nl:8068/"/><bookmark name="Canada Classical" url="http://91.121.166.38:7210/"/><bookmark name="KDFC FM 102.1 Bay Area" url="http://c1.mp3.liquidcompass.net/KDFCFM"/><bookmark name="Minnesota Public Radio" url="http://classicalstream1.publicradio.org:80/"/><bookmark name="Venice Classic Radio" url="http://109.123.116.202:8020"/><bookmark name="VPR" url="http://vprclassical.streamguys.net:80/vprclassical64.mp3"/><bookmark name="WITF-FM" url="http://sc2.lga.llnw.net:80/stream/witf_mp3"/><bookmark name="WYPR-All Classical Baltimore" url="http://live.str3am.com:9190/wypr-hd3"/></group>Or you can edit the group name to something like <group name="Your Name Classical"> and just append it to the file before the final:

</group>
</bookmarks>
